Large bandwidth for higher data rate is achieved by using

A

high frequency carrier wave

B

high frequency audio wave

C

low frequency carrier wave

D

low frequency audio wave

To solve the question regarding how large bandwidth for higher data rate is achieved, we can follow these steps: ### Step-by-Step Solution: 1. **Understanding Bandwidth**: - Bandwidth refers to the range of frequencies within a given band that can be used for transmitting data. It is essentially the difference between the highest and lowest frequencies in that band. 2. **Carrier Waves**: - A carrier wave is a continuous electromagnetic wave that can be modulated with an input signal for the purpose of conveying information. The carrier wave's frequency is crucial as it determines the bandwidth available for data transmission. 3. **Relationship Between Bandwidth and Data Rate**: - The data rate (or bit rate) is the amount of data that can be transmitted in a given amount of time. According to the Nyquist theorem, the maximum data rate is directly proportional to the bandwidth of the channel. This means that a larger bandwidth allows for a higher data rate. 4. **Modulation**: - Modulation is the process of varying one or more properties of a carrier wave in accordance with the information signal. The modulation technique used can affect the efficiency of bandwidth usage. 5. **Higher Frequency Carrier Waves**: - To achieve a large bandwidth and, consequently, a higher data rate, it is essential to use higher frequency carrier waves. Higher frequencies can accommodate more data and allow for more carrier waves to exist within the same bandwidth. 6. **Conclusion**: - Therefore, to achieve a large bandwidth for higher data rates, one should use higher frequency carrier waves. ### Final Answer: Large bandwidth for higher data rate is achieved by using **higher frequency carrier waves**. ---
